Get Involved
There are many ways of getting involved in Anarchist Black Cross work.
You or your group can:
If you are an individual interested specifically in getting involved
with the Anarchist Black Cross movement or are with a group that wants
to join or start an ABC group, great! If you or a group you work with
is considering affiliating with the Anarchist Black Cross movement, keep
the following in mind:
-
The Anarchist Black Cross movement is decentralized and anti-authoritarian.
We do not require to sign on to bylaws or other policies are a means
to join or be involved. How your group operates and has operated is
completely up to you. All our projects are voluntary (meaning you
participate as your time allows). One of the goals here is to facilitate
better communications of and actions by different anti-prison groups
and developing a united front against the state and its weapons of
incarceration, poverty, border controls, capitalism, colonialism and
genocide.
-
The Anarchist Black Cross movement is not a 'single-issue' organization.
While the Anarchist Black Cross movement addresses issues of incarceration
and criminalization, affiliated groups see these issues in the context
of a larger picture -- namely, a systen and its enforcers, capital
and laws aimed at oppression. Groups are encouraged to be active on
as many fronts as they can.
-
The Anarchist Black Cross movement is nonsectarian. We welcome
organizations that aren't explicitly ABC groups and groups that may
not have anarchist in their names, but which all support the roots
of the ABC movement in the fight against prisons as a revolutionary
battle against the state.
-
The Anarchist Black Cross movement respects, encourages and acknowledges
a diversity of tactics and autonomy among affiliates. We welcome
a variety of perspectives in our tasks in the cause of unity and revolution.
Whether your work is primarily around police accountability, political
prisoners, youth rights, 'nonpolitical' prisoners fighting for their
religious freedoms, earth liberation prisoners, gentrification or
community empowerment, recognize that we have a common struggle and
get involved.
